> I have heard this "aptitude is prefered" before but have never seen
any official documentation to support it.

>From the dpkg man page:

"dpkg is a tool to install, build, remove and manage Debian packages.
The primary and more user-friendly front-end for dpkg is aptitude(1)."

I agree with Evan that there should be some global configuration for
this, but it seems to me that aptitude as a default is better than apt-
get, and we're going to need a default either way.
